Literary Exploration: Stapelgedichten Spark Creativity
Students in the first and second grades recently participated in a unique literary activity: creating stapelgedichten
– or “stack poems.” This involves stacking books to form a poem using the titles on the spines. As described in a recent report, Een stapelgedicht is een kort, vaak rijmloos gedicht dat ontstaat door boeken op elkaar te stapelen. Door de titels op de boekruggen van boven naar beneden te lezen, ontstaat er een nieuw gedicht of verhaal.
This activity took place during the Week of Poetry, fostering a playful and imaginative approach to language.

Ecosphere Project: A Lesson in Sustainability
Third-year students embarked on an ecological project, creating their own ecospheres. These self-contained ecosystems, built with drainage layers, activated carbon, garden soil, and succulents, aim to demonstrate the principles of the carbon cycle and self-sufficiency. The project embodies the school’s commitment to door te doen
– learning by doing.
